As we dive into 2023, the kitchen remains a central hub in modern homes, inspiring innovative designs and trending features that blend aesthetics with practicality. One of the standout trends is the increasing use of sustainable materials, such as bamboo and recycled metals, which add a touch of eco-friendliness to your cooking space. Smart technology has also made significant strides, allowing homeowners to control appliances through voice commands or smartphones, making cooking more efficient and enjoyable.
Another key trend is the rise of open-concept kitchens that promote social interaction, featuring large islands that serve as both cooking and dining areas. Bold colors and intricate tile patterns are taking center stage, with many opting for unique backsplashes that make a statement. Furthermore, multifunctional furniture continues to gain popularity, merging style with utility to maximize space, especially in smaller homes.
